Q. Which of the following indicators is used in acid-base titration involving strong acid and strong base?

  • (A) Phenolphthalein
  • (B) Methyl orange
  • (C) Litmus
  • (D) Congo red
  • Correct Answer - Option(A)

Explanation by: Shyam Dubey
Phenolphthalein changes color near pH 7, making it ideal for titrations involving strong acids and bases. Methyl orange is better suited for strong acid–weak base titrations.
